Missile strike on Kharkiv: Injury toll rises to 54, one person killed

image

The number of people injured in a Russian missile strike on Kharkiv has risen to 54, with one person killed in the attack.

Kharkiv Mayor Ihor Terekhov reported the updated figures on Telegram, according to Ukrinform.

“Fifty-four people were injured as a result of this morning’s missile strike on Kharkiv,” he wrote.

Meanwhile, Oleh Syniehubov, head of the Kharkiv Regional Military Administration, reported that 13 people — including two children — had been hospitalized.

According to him, four of the injured are in serious condition. Doctors are providing all necessary medical assistance.

The strike hit a densely populated area of Kharkiv. Initial reports indicated a missile had struck a residential high-rise and that 20 people were injured. Later updates said one person was killed in the attack.
